53% Of Americans Consider Product Reviews And Ratings As The Most Vital Part Of The Online Shopping Experience In 2018.
Today's buyers are wary and desire the best bang for their buck. It's no wonder that they consider reading reviews as a huge part of the buying decision.
Source: Statista
Facebook Reviews Affect More Than 50% Of Consumers' Purchasing Decisions
Facebook is currently the most popular social network which can likewise influence our buying decisions.
According to social media reviews data, Facebook affects more than half of users' purchase choices.
Facebook reviews statistics reveal that 4 out of 5 users are more likely to trust a local business if it has favorable reviews.
Source: RevLocal
Unfavorable Reviews Can Boost Conversion By As Much As 85%
It sounds insane, but negative reviews can be a positive driver for users to devote more time on your website. According to online review statistics, people devote more than five times as long on a website when they read negative reviews.
More than two thirds of users trust reviews more when there are a mix of positives and negatives. An overwhelming 95 percent suspect censorship or fabricated reviews if there aren't any unfavorable ones.
Source: Reevoo

88% Of Executives View Reputation Risk As A Top Business Concern
Reputation management statistics suggest a business's reputation does not affect just the consumers. Potential team members likewise look at rankings and read reviews.
Source: Deloitte
71% Of Millennials Browse Customer Reviews Of Expert Services
More than half of all people in need of an expert service turn to online reviews.
According to online reviews statistics, 59% used online reviews to select a lawyer or a physician.
Young people (age 18-35) are even more inclined to employ an expert based on online reviews. Just 19% of millennials will consider working with a legal representative without any.
Source: Thomson Reuters

Online Product Reviews About An Item Can Boost Its Conversion Rate By More Than 270%
User review stats reveal the purchase possibility for a product with five reviews is 270% higher than the very same product without reviews.
Source: Spiegel Research Center

61% Of Local Businesses Have An Average Score Of 4 Or 5 Stars
Typically two thirds of companies have excellent and exceptional scores. Only 5% of companies have a rating listed below 3 stars.
Source: Brightlocal
